#132059 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#132059 is composed of 7.5% red, 12.5%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.7% cyan, 64%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 228.9 degrees, a saturation of 64.8% and a lightness of 21.2%. #132059 color hex could be obtained by blending #2640b2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

Shades and Tints of #132059

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020308 is the darkest color, while #f7f8f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#132059

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#343538 is the less saturated color, while #02166a is the most saturated one.
